You are currently viewing Solving Qemu Debug Symbol Problem

Solving Qemu Debug Symbol Problem

Today’s guide is designed to help you when you get a qemu debug symbol error.

Updated

  • 1. Download ASR Pro
  • 2. Run the program
  • 3. Click "Scan Now" to find and remove any viruses on your computer
  • Speed up your computer today with this simple download.

    Start Provides Qemu

    qemu has two debug command line options that GDB has: -s and -S. The first orders QEMU to listento listen for GDB connections on localhost:1234 (but not listening on it as well), the second one stops the guest CPU on boot, so debugging works fine from the start. If you enter the emulation using the tools/ew.py script, you can add the following options:

    Updated

    Are you tired of your computer running slow? Annoyed by frustrating error messages? ASR Pro is the solution for you! Our recommended tool will quickly diagnose and repair Windows issues while dramatically increasing system performance. So don't wait any longer, download ASR Pro today!


    What is intrusive debugging in QEMU?

    Intrusive debugging requires QEMU options if you want to connect to its GDB server, and redundant GDB commands to start a debug session. QEMU includes a remote GDB machine that you can connect to to debug your QEMU application.

    Enable Networking In QEMU

    The run-zircon script, when the -N factor is specified, tries to builda network interface running a network of Linux Tun/Tap devices called “qemu”. QEMUno need to pay special privileges, but for this kind you have toCreate a permanent tun/tap software beforehand (requires you and your family to be root):

    qemu debug icon

    Debugging Tips

    GDB is your friend. Use the qemu-gdb Son target (or variant) qemu-gdb-nox to build it.QEMU is waiting for a GDB connection. See GDB linkSee below as some of the commands are useful when debugging the kernel.

    Debugging The Kernel From String

    Compiling the control kernel produces a zipped logo file, bzImage, and an uncompressed object file, vmlinux . While running qemu bzImage, each of our debuggers requires vmlinux, which is usually built into the distribution’s root. Run

    To Debug ki. Writing QEMU Log Files From

    QEMU allows you to redirect anything you send to COM1 to bring the absolute file to your host machine. To encourage this feature, you should add most of the following flags when starting QEMU:

    Runs Much Less Xv6 Than QEMU

    A small filesystem that you explore and then modify herelocated on a second dedicated hard drive,whose initial content qemu initializes from your current fs.img file.Later in this course, you will probably learn how xv6accesses this type of system and modifies files.

    How to use QEMU with GDB?

    If you’re only calling qemu from gdb, you probably want to ignore SIGUSR1 (“process SIGUSR1 noprint”). You can also invoke qemu with the -gdb option (or the -s shortcut) and get a gdb stub. You could then probably connect to the network from any computer (run gdb, then get “target remote :“). See the help page for more information.

    Speed up your computer today with this simple download.

    Icône De Débogage Qemu
    Qemu-Debug-Symbol
    Qemu Debug-ikon
    Значок отладки Qemu
    Ikona Debugowania Qemu
    Qemu 디버그 아이콘
    Icono De Depuración De Qemu
    Icona Di Debug Di Qemu
    Ícone De Depuração Do Qemu
    Qemu-foutopsporingspictogram